The Stampin’ Schach Design Tips

The Holly Berry dies collection is absolutely perfect for creating a gorgeous focal cluster.  Holly berries were die cut from Cherry Cobbler card stock, and accented with a Distressed Gold overlay. Mossy Meadow backs the leaves of the large Distressed Gold label die cut, while Evening Evergreen pine needles peek out from behind. Fussy cut leaves, courtesy of one of the patterns from Boughs of Holly designer series paper, add to the fun. Of course, a Textural Element piece and gold Festive Pearls are the perfect accents.
